What You’re Actually Getting (and Why It Matters)

The Back to School Graduation Cap Vector package delivers two core files in one ZIP: a high-resolution JPEG (4000×2584 px) and a fully editable EPS vector file. That means you get both immediate usability and long-term adaptability—no guesswork, no compatibility headaches.

The JPEG works straight out of the box: drop it into Canva, PowerPoint, or a blog post and go. But the real value lives in the EPS file—it contains 100 individual vector shapes. That’s not marketing jargon. It means you can isolate the tassel, recolor the mortarboard, adjust spacing between stars or stripes, or scale the entire cap to billboard size without a single pixel blurring. No raster limitations. No “I wish this were editable” moments later.

You don’t need Adobe Illustrator to use it—but if you have it, you’ll appreciate how cleanly each shape layers and labels. Even beginners using Affinity Designer or Inkscape can unlock most edits thanks to its clean structure and logical grouping.

What to Keep in Mind Before You Use It

Even great assets work best when matched to realistic expectations. First: this is a single-cap illustration, not a full toolkit of academic icons. It won’t include diplomas, pencils, or apples—just one versatile, well-executed cap. That focus is intentional. It means no bloat, no unused elements cluttering your layers, and no confusion about which parts are editable.

Second: while the ZIP file is lightweight and extracts easily (double-click works on most modern OSes), make sure you’re using extraction software compatible with your system—WinRAR, WinZIP, or built-in utilities like macOS Archive Utility or Windows File Explorer. If you’re on a Chromebook or tablet, verify your file manager supports ZIP extraction before downloading.

Third: consider your output context. Printing large banners? Stick with the EPS. Sharing via email or embedding in Notion? The JPEG is faster and universally supported. Need transparency? Open the EPS in your vector editor and export as PNG with transparent background—no extra plugins or conversions needed.
